                My Race started failing at tracking HR and sleep after the SW update as well. Switching off and on the watch seems to fix the issue for a couple of days, but it comes back. I tried a factory reset with same results. My wife got a new Race S for Christmas and it updated the SW right out of the box, same issues with sleep and HR tracking.

                    Sleep tracking and HR issues here as well. Sleep tracking is completely off for me since the last update and HR stopped working yesterday. After a soft reset it worked again. And the battery drain seems to get worse and worse with every update. I’m now on 50 percent of the runtime in daily usage than before the switch to customizable complications. I still love my watch and have hopes in a bug fix, but I’m getting more and more disappointed. By the way, I run on my second unit. Had to return the first one with another problem.

                      Just want to add that I might have found a sort of pattern for Sleep Tracking problems on my Race. In my case sleep tracking fails (no sleep registered) only after I’ve recorded an activity (mostly running, with HR belt and some S+ apps). Then, after soft reset everything works perfectly until the next activity is registered.

                        Hello, I found a solution to return to normal regarding sleep tracking. My watch had the heart rate measurement that stopped during one night (for no reason) and therefore the sleep tracking did not work. I stopped/started the watch, the heart rate measurement resumed, but the sleep tracking still did not work. This lasted 3 days. Afterwards, I stopped/started the watch again then stopped/started the sleep tracking and on the start phase, I adjusted the related functions (sleep target duration, do not disturb duration, blood oxygen tracking on and HRV tracking on). Since then, sleep tracking has been working pretty well again. To be continued if this lasts over time. It remains to be understood why the Cardio measurement stopped during one night, which has happened twice since the last update.
